<p>In a message released on the occasion of International Women’s Day, the National Secretariat of the Federation of Cuban Women (FMC) congratulated all women in the country and called for commemorations of the date, despite the difficult conditions created by COVID-19.</p>
<p>&#8220;Nothing can overshadow the advances in equality and social inclusion that have been achieved over these 62 years of revolutionary triumph, during which we have been protagonists and direct beneficiaries of programs promoting health, motherhood, diversification of food production, educational advancement for professionals and skilled workers, broader employment opportunities, promotion to management and decision-making positions, the visualization of women&#8217;s work in all branches of artistic creation and much more,&#8221; the statement asserts.</p>
<p>The FMC leadership recounts the many reasons women are marching around the world today, demanding equal rights which, for millions, are only a dream.</p>
<p>The document reiterates the satisfaction Cuban women feel in having their rights enshrined in the Constitution of the Republic, and in permanent efforts underway to improve the work of those responsible for their enforcement.</p>
<p>The FMC National Secretariat reiterated its defense of the conquests achieved in our country, describing Cuban women as &#8220;worthy daughters of this indomitable, free, independent and sovereign homeland,&#8221; and reaffirmed its loyalty to the Revolution under the principle of intransigence captured in the words &#8220;Homeland or Death.&#8221;</p>
<p>AN EMBRACE FROM CUBA</p>
<p>Consistent with the spirit of continental sisterhood reflected in its name and raison d&#8217;être, Cuba’s Casa de las Americas reiterated its solidarity &#8220;with the struggles of Latin American and Caribbean women for their rights and, specifically, for a post-pandemic future with less violence, less gender discrimination and more equity.&#8221;</p>
<p>Noted in the message are the difficulties women on the continent face, which have been exacerbated by the epidemic, in terms of employment, income and family responsibilities, and reiterated the institution’s commitment to supporting their demands for full equality.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-16626" alt="Viet Nam secret PCC" src="/files/2021/02/Viet-Nam-secret-PCC.jpg" width="300" height="248" />The President of the Republic of Cuba, Miguel Díaz-Canel Bermúdez, yesterday February1, tweeted congratulations to Nguyen Phu Trong, who was re-elected as General Secretary of the Communist Party of Vietnam (CPV).</p>
<p>Phu Trong, who will assume his third consecutive term, won resounding support given to his capable management of state affairs, including the successful battle waged against the COVID-19 pandemic, according to information released by the national radio station Voice of Vietnam.</p>
<p>The General Secretary expressed his commitment, before the Congress, the entire Party, the people and army, to make his best efforts to overcome all obstacles and successfully fulfill the tasks assigned to him, according to national media.</p>
<p>The election took place during the XIII Congress of the CPV which has been in session since January 25. The Party gathering also elected a new 18-member Political Bureau, the Secretariat and Disciplinary Control Commission.</p>
<p>TeleSUR also reported that the 1,587delegates participating in the Congress, the membership, leaders of state organizations and citizens, including those living abroad, analyzed the documents on which the CPV will base its work in the coming period, leading the political, social and economic process of the country with a socialist and participative orientation.</p>
<p>Thus, following this broad discussion, the XIII Congress Resolution was approved, which honors the 35 years of Doi Moi (Renovation) and confirms the success of Vietnam’s socialist system, as well as the strong unity evident between the Party, the army and the people.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-15711" alt="cuba Korea" src="/files/2020/09/cuba-Korea.jpg" width="300" height="247" />The relationship shared by the peoples, governments and parties of Cuba and the Democratic People’s Republic of Korea (DPRK) has lasted six decades, almost the Revolution’s entire life.</p>
<p>The first secretary of the Communist Party of Cuba Central Committee, Army General Raúl Castro Ruz, and President of the Republic Miguel Díaz-Canel Bermúdez sent a message of congratulations to Kim Jong Un, on the 60th anniversary of relations between the two countries.</p>
<p>“Celebrating six decades since the establishment of diplomatic relations between Cuba and the Democratic People’s Republic of Korea, we extend to you the most cordial congratulations in the name of the people, the Communist Party and government of Cuba,” the message read, according to the Korean Central News Agency, reported Prensa Latina.</p>
<p>“We take advantage of the occasion to reaffirm the high priority Cuba gives the ties of friendship and cooperation between our two countries, built on the foundation of the special relationship shared by our historic leaders, Fidel Castro Ruz and Kim Il Sung,” the missive adds.</p>
<p>On the occasion of the commemoration, Korean leader Kim Jong Un also sent a greeting to Raúl and Díaz-Canel, reiterating his personal support to the just cause of the Cuban people, defending their revolutionary conquests.</p>
<p>Over the past 60 years, both peoples have invariably defended, consolidated, and developed the noble traditions of friendship, solidarity and cooperation, Kim Jong Un noted.</p>
<p>He emphasized that the friendship between the two nations was created by two great leaders, Kim Il Sung and Fidel Castro, within the context of difficult international conditions and provocative challenges from hostile forces.</p>
<p>Since August 29, 1960, Havana and Pyongyang have maintained diplomatic relations. Cuba has always been able to count on the support of the DPRK in the struggle to end the unjust economic, commercial and financial blockade imposed on our island by the United States.</p>
<p>The two countries share a high level of agreement on the principal issues of international interest and cooperate regularly in multi-lateral bodies.</p>
